Output 171a5aef4a50d0e8de7ff74b57d734f144ecb53acb7a88da4647fbb5ad6be88a:0

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e80c20008fd621818ca0934d4ff9173d304ce80f OP_EQUAL
address
3NqyDWTmzVPcrL12uaZdathbSCNe9fvKVz
transaction
171a5aef4a50d0e8de7ff74b57d734f144ecb53acb7a88da4647fbb5ad6be88a
spent
true